The Eigenvalue Perturbation Bound for Arbitrary Matrices

Wen Li & Jian-Xin Chen

J. Comp. Math., 24 (2006), pp. 141-148.

Published online: 2006-04

Export citation
  • Abstract

In this paper we present some new absolute and relative perturbation bounds for the eigenvalue for arbitrary matrices, which improves some recent results. The eigenvalue inclusion region is also discussed.
